Resumen:
E cadherin (E cadh) is the main cell adhesion molecule localized at adherensjunctions (AJs). Dynamic remodeling of AJs is crucial at maintaining tissue int egrity and coordinating collective cell movements during animal embryogenesis. The posterior lateral line primordium (pLLP) in zebrafish is a powerful model system to study guided migration and epithelial morphogenesis, being amenable to live imaging.By combining high resolution microscopy in zebrafish embryos expressing E cadhGFP and automatic segmentation algorithms in 4D, we implemented a routine toanalyze E cadh distribution in vivo during pLLP migration.At every time point analysed we found a polarized distribution of E cadh expression along the pLLP, with lower expression in cells at the leading front and at higher levels in cells at the trailing end. During one hour time lapse the total area of the pLLP did not change significantly and the glo bal displacement measured was ~50 µm at 24°C.We proposed that this patterned E cadh distribution at the front and trailing regions of pLLP may be related to differences in local velocity of the cells within those regions. To test this we are currently wo rking to obtain instantaneous velocity fields from the segmented image sequences by using PIV (Particle Image Velocimetry) analysis, a technique routinely used in fluid dynamics with unexplored potential to understand morphogenetic movements.
